Enum JobState

    • Enum Constant Detail

      • CANCELED

        public static final JobState CANCELED
        The job was canceled. This is a final state for the job.
      • CANCELING

        public static final JobState CANCELING
        The job is in the process of being canceled. This is a transient state for the job.
      • ERROR

        public static final JobState ERROR
        The job has encountered an error. This is a final state for the job.
      • FINISHED

        public static final JobState FINISHED
        The job is finished. This is a final state for the job.
      • PROCESSING

        public static final JobState PROCESSING
        The job is processing. This is a transient state for the job.
      • QUEUED

        public static final JobState QUEUED
        The job is in a queued state, waiting for resources to become available. This is a transient state.
      • SCHEDULED

        public static final JobState SCHEDULED
        The job is being scheduled to run on an available resource. This is a transient state, between queued and processing states.
    • Method Detail

      • values

        public static JobState[] values()
        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:
        for (JobState c : JobState.values())
            System.out.println(c);
        
        Returns:
        an array containing the constants of this enum type, in the order they are declared
      • valueOf

        public static JobState valueOf​(String name)
        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)
        Parameters:
        name - the name of the enum constant to be returned.
        Returns:
        the enum constant with the specified name
        Throws:
        IllegalArgumentException - if this enum type has no constant with the specified name
        NullPointerException - if the argument is null
      • fromString

        public static JobState fromString​(String value)
        Parses a serialized value to a JobState instance.
        Parameters:
        value - the serialized value to parse.
        Returns:
        the parsed JobState object, or null if unable to parse.